The Importance of Pollination
Pollination is a vital process in the reproduction of many plants. Bees, particularly honeybees and bumblebees, are among the most effective pollinators. They transfer pollen from one flower to another, facilitating fertilization and the production of fruits and seeds. Approximately 75% of the world’s flowering plants depend on animal pollinators, with bees being the most significant contributors.
Crops Dependent on Bee Pollination
Many crops that form the foundation of our diets rely on bee pollination. This includes fruits like apples, almonds, blueberries, and cherries, as well as vegetables such as cucumbers, pumpkins, and squash. According to the Food and Agriculture Organization (FAO), around 35% of global food production is directly linked to bee pollination. This statistic highlights the essential role bees play in ensuring food security.
Economic Impact of Bees
The economic contribution of bees to agriculture is enormous. It is estimated that bees contribute over $15 billion annually to the U.S. economy alone through their pollination services. This figure encompasses not only the value of the crops produced but also the jobs created in agriculture and related industries. The decline in bee populations poses a significant threat to this economic stability.
Impact on Global Food Supply
The decline in bee populations can lead to a dramatic decrease in food supply. Without sufficient pollination, many crops would fail to produce adequate yields, resulting in higher food prices and increased food scarcity. This situation is particularly concerning as the global population continues to grow, increasing the demand for food. Protecting bee populations is vital not only for maintaining current food production levels but also for future food security.
Threats to Bee Populations
Despite their importance, bee populations are facing numerous threats. Pesticides, habitat loss, climate change, and diseases are significant factors contributing to the decline in bee numbers. The use of certain agricultural chemicals can be harmful to bees, reducing their populations and impairing their ability to pollinate effectively. Additionally, urbanization and land development have led to the loss of natural habitats where bees thrive.
Climate Change and Its Effects
Climate change is altering the natural habitats of bees, affecting their foraging patterns and reproductive cycles. As temperatures rise and weather patterns change, the availability of flowers that provide food for bees can be disrupted. This can lead to mismatches between the timing of flowering plants and the life cycles of bees, further threatening their survival.
Conservation Efforts
Recognizing the importance of bees, various conservation efforts are underway to protect these vital pollinators. Initiatives include creating bee-friendly habitats, reducing pesticide use, and promoting organic farming practices. Community gardens and urban green spaces can also provide essential resources for bees, helping to sustain their populations.
Supporting Local Beekeepers
Supporting local beekeepers is another effective way to contribute to bee conservation. By purchasing honey and other bee products from local sources, consumers can help sustain beekeeping operations and promote healthy bee populations. Additionally, educational programs aimed at raising awareness about the importance of bees can foster a greater appreciation for these insects and encourage more people to take action in their preservation.
